Regulatory gap analysis: FCA vulnerability review
Following our latest blog on the FCA’s findings from its review of firms’ treatment of vulnerable customers, we have developed a comprehensive gap analysis to help firms assess and align their frameworks with the FCA’s Vulnerability Finalised Guidance (FG21/1) and relevant sections of the Consumer Duty.
Our gap analysis is available below. We have converted the examples of good practices and areas for improvement into a robust set of questions designed to help you evaluate your vulnerability framework. We encourage you to go through the self-assessment questions and rigorously challenge the adequacy of your framework against the Regulator’s expectations.
From the review, it is clear that while progress has been made, there are still areas where further enhancement is needed. Firms should use this analysis to ensure their frameworks meet expectations.
